Key Market Trends Fueling Growth

The global couriers market has experienced significant growth in the adoption of electric delivery vehicles due to increasing sustainability concerns and operational efficiency needs. With the rise of e-commerce and last-mile delivery services, courier companies are transitioning to electric fleets to address environmental issues, reduce costs, and improve delivery capabilities. The environmental benefits of electric vehicles (EVs), such as reduced or zero greenhouse gas emissions and cleaner urban environments, are driving their adoption. Additionally, EVs offer lower fuel and maintenance costs, government incentives, and the ability to navigate urban areas effectively. Companies like FedEx and DHL are leading the way, collaborating with manufacturers like TATA and Ford to deploy EVs for last-mile delivery. Advancements in EV technology, including extended battery range and rapid charging infrastructure, are further increasing the feasibility of larger-scale integration. These factors are expected to boost the growth of the global couriers market.

Market Challenges

The global couriers market faces significant challenges due to the intricacy of route planning and optimization, intensified by urbanization and traffic congestion. Urban areas host a high concentration of delivery locations within limited spaces, making efficient route planning essential for courier companies. However, congested roads hinder timely deliveries, escalating operational costs, and reducing productivity. To address these issues, companies invest in advanced route optimization technologies and strategies. Traditional point-to-point delivery methods no longer suffice, as urban landscapes demand intricate planning to accommodate traffic patterns, construction, road closures, and restricted access areas. This added complexity negatively impacts courier services’ operational efficiency, affecting delivery schedules and customer satisfaction. KUALA LUMPUR, Malaysia, July 23,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— The Roundtable on Sustainable Palm Oil (RSPO) has released a guidance document, “Leveraging RSPO Principles and Criteria for IFRS® Sustainability Disclosure Standards”. This new resource supports certified sustainable palm oil producers to align their sustainability practices with the IFRS S1 and IFRS S2 disclosure standards that serve as the global framework for reporting sustainability-related financial information.

As more than 30 jurisdictions, representing around 60% of global GDP, move towards adoption of the IFRS Sustainability Disclosure Standards (IFRS SDS), companies are increasingly required to disclose how sustainability-related risks and opportunities affect their financial position and prospects.1

This resource provides a practical pathway for palm oil producers to respond to these requirements by leveraging their existing compliance with the RSPO Principles and Criteria (P&C), without duplicating efforts or creating parallel systems.

Informing investor-relevant disclosures: A four-step approach

Certification and the IFRS SDS serve different purposes. This guidance, developed with support from PwC Malaysia, provides a practical bridge between operational sustainability practices and financial disclosure expectations by helping members translate certification-related topics, metrics, and evidence to inform investor-relevant disclosures.

It sets out a four-step approach to IFRS SDS-aligned reporting, guiding RSPO Members on applicability, reporting boundaries, identification of sustainability-related risks and opportunities, and links to financial performance. It also includes seven practical examples, illustrating how the RSPO P&C requirements and implementation evidence can inform disclosures across key sustainability topics, from ethical conduct and legal compliance to environmental protection and worker health and safety.

Beyond growers, the guidance document also supports financial institutions by helping banks, insurers, and investors understand how palm oil sustainability issues, such as labour disputes and traceability gaps, can translate into financial risks, impacts, and opportunities, enabling clearer risk profiling and more informed financing decisions.

WALTHAM, Mass., 23 July 2026 /PRNewswire/ — Nordic Capital today announced that it has entered into a definitive agreement to sell ArisGlobal, a leading provider of software to the life sciences industry, to Dassault Systèmes (Euronext Paris: FR0014003TT8) (Paris: DSY.PA). The transaction represents a full exit for Nordic Capital and marks the successful culmination of a partnership that has transformed ArisGlobal into a scaled, cloud-native and AI-enabled platform serving more than 200 life sciences companies, CROs and government health authorities worldwide.

Founded in 1989 and headquartered in Waltham, Massachusetts, ArisGlobal develops and delivers regulatory, safety, and quality software to a global client base that includes many of the world’s largest pharmaceutical and biotech organisations, as well as regulatory authorities. Its flagship LifeSphere® platform is a fully integrated, cloud-native suite that enables life sciences organisations to manage complex regulatory submissions, pharmacovigilance workflows and clinical data on a single platform, improving compliance, speed and operational efficiency. The platform also embeds advanced AI-enabled automation across core pharmacovigilance workflows, reducing manual processing and accelerating safety case management.

“Nordic Capital invested in ArisGlobal because the business had strong fundamentals, a loyal blue-chip client base and significant potential to modernise its technology and scale its commercial reach. Working closely with Aman and his team, Nordic Capital has supported the company’s transformation into a leading cloud-native platform for the life sciences industry with differentiated AI-enabled capabilities and a strengthened market position. Nordic Capital is proud of what has been achieved together with management and looks forward to seeing the company continue to grow under Dassault Systèmes ownership,” said Daniel Berglund, Partner and Head of Healthcare, Nordic Capital Advisors.

Nordic Capital first invested in ArisGlobal in 2019, partnering with the founding family and management team to pursue an ambitious development strategy. In 2021, Nordic Capital made a further investment in the company, reflecting its conviction in ArisGlobal’s growth potential and the progress achieved since the original partnership began. Throughout the ownership period, Nordic Capital worked closely with management to accelerate the SaaS transition, professionalise the go-to-market organisation, broaden the product offering and strengthen the leadership team.

The migration to a modern, cloud-native architecture created the foundation for ArisGlobal to become an early leader in the application of AI to drug safety. A key milestone was the development and launch of NavaX, ArisGlobal’s generative AI solution for safety case processing, which automates and accelerates core pharmacovigilance workflows and has been adopted by a number of the world’s leading pharmaceutical companies. NavaX has further differentiated ArisGlobal’s offering and marked an important step in the Company’s evolution into a broader, AI-enabled safety and regulatory software platform.

Alongside its technology transformation, ArisGlobal strengthened its management team and commercial organisation, while two strategic acquisitions broadened the Company’s platform capabilities. Today, ArisGlobal serves more than 200 enterprise customers, including half of the world’s top 50 biopharma companies, processes more than 12 million safety cases annually and is expected to generate approximately USD 175 million in revenue in 2026. As rising regulatory complexity and increasing volumes of adverse event reporting continue to drive demand for advanced life sciences software, ArisGlobal is well positioned for future growth through solutions that automate compliance workflows, reduce manual processing and enable organisations to manage regulatory risk more effectively.

The transaction brings together ArisGlobal’s leadership in AI-enabled safety and regulatory software with Dassault Systèmes’ capabilities across research, clinical development and manufacturing. Nordic Capital believes the combination represents a highly compelling strategic fit, pairing complementary capabilities to create a broader, end-to-end offering across the life sciences value chain. ArisGlobal will also benefit from Dassault Systèmes’ global scale, customer reach and investment capacity, providing a strong platform for its next phase of innovation and growth.

The transaction is subject to customary regulatory approvals and is expected to close in the second half of 2026.

BANGKOK, July 23,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— Cognizant (Nasdaq: CTSH), a leading AI builder and global technology services provider, and Gulf Edge Company Limited, the digital infrastructure arm of Thai energy and infrastructure conglomerate Gulf Development Public Company Limited (GULF) or Gulf Group, today announced a landmark strategic partnership. The alliance is designed to accelerate enterprise AI adoption and establish a resilient, AI-native digital economy in Thailand and the broader region.

As artificial intelligence (AI) rapidly reshapes industries, economies, and societies worldwide, the partnership aims to establish the foundational ecosystem needed to enable Thailand’s next phase of digital transformation. By combining trusted sovereign digital infrastructure with world-class AI engineering and enterprise transformation capabilities, Gulf Edge and Cognizant will help organizations deploy AI securely, responsibly, and at scale.

The collaboration brings together Gulf Edge’s leadership in digital infrastructure, energy, cloud, and strategic relationships across Thailand’s most important industries with Cognizant’s global expertise in AI, digital engineering, cloud modernization, data, and intelligent operations. Together, the two companies will deliver end-to-end AI capabilities spanning infrastructure, AI platforms, enterprise solutions, systems integration, and managed services.

The partnership will initially focus on accelerating AI adoption across key sectors including banking and financial services, energy and utilities, healthcare, telecommunications, manufacturing, and the public sector. Through industry-specific AI solutions, organizations will be able to improve operational efficiency, enhance customer experience, strengthen decision-making, automate complex business processes, and unlock new opportunities for innovation and growth.
